But, it is a shocking simple fact. You pay less tax on a dollars of earnings even more tax on your private last usd. Let us assume you are single and your taxable income covers to $45,000 during this year. Then you pay federal tax in the rate of 10 percent on the actual $8,350 of taxable income. Another 15% imposed on income between $8,350 and $33,950. 25% is charged on income from $33,950 to $45,000.
